John Travolta today paid tribute to his Grease co-star Jeff Conaway.
He described the actor, who played T-Bird Kenickie Murdock alongside his character Danny Zuko, as a 'wonderful and decent man'.
He said in a statement: 'My heartfelt thoughts are with his family and loved ones at this very difficult time.'
'We will miss him.'
The 60-year-old died this morning after a long battle with drug and alcohol addiction.

He was taken off life support yesterday and passed away this morning at Encino Tarzana Medical Center.

He was taken there unconscious on May 11 after an overdose and placed in a medically induced coma.

Conaway had been treating himself with pain pills and cold medicine while in a weakened condition, his manager Phil Brock said.
Of his troubled client, Brock said: 'He's a gentle soul with a good heart... but he's never been able to exorcise his demons.'

His manager Kathryn Boole told RadarOnline.com: 'Jeff will be greatly missed – he was a true artist and very intelligent and sensitive human being – we have been receiving messages of support and love from around the world today.'
